Yes, we offer School Leaver Transition to Supports which includes:
- Work skills Incentive Program
- money handling skills
- time management skills
- communication skills
- discovery activities
- work experience
- job ready skills
- travel skills
- personal development skills

Yes. We have a large front door and entry hallway, 3 individual rooms for arts & crafts, media & gaming, and sensory, plus full kitchen and separate laundry facilities. We have a large Australia standard Disability bathroom and shower.
Our large conference table doubles as a lunch room where we can all sit together and office administration rooms. We also have a massive grassed outdoor area.
The Sounds and Senses, Sensory Room is beautifully decorated and is the perfect place for some quiet time to chill out. It has a huge “Therapy Pod”, low level lighting, visual displays, projector for catching up on some Netflix or watching a movie, sensory toys and relaxing sounds and smells.
